A lot of effort went into Gillian Anderson’s viral vagina dress.

It’s been three months since the actress, 55, kicked off the 2024 awards season at the Golden Globes in a custom Gabriela Hearst gown covered in an embroidered vagina motif. The Internet, however, has yet to recover from the statement-making look.

During an April 3 interview on The Late Show with Stephen Colbert, host Stephen Colbert asked Anderson if she expected the dress to make “such a splash” online. Her reply: absolutely not.

“It was an idea, it happened. It was manifested,” she said as Colbert complimented the “wonderful embroidery.”

“It must’ve taken forever,” he added. “Forever. Many many many hours, many vaginas — vulvas,” Anderson replied, correcting herself. According to Gabriela Hearst, the label, each motif on the dress took 3.5 hours to embroider.

Inside the venue, she told PEOPLE that the dress had a floral inspiration, noting what she loved most about it was that “it’s covered in peonies!”

When asked to expand why the design was so “brand appropriate," as she described it to Deadline in January, Anderson listed all her projects, some of which lend themselves to double entendres.

Included is her role as sex therapist Jean Milburn on Netflix’s Sex Education, her wellness-inspired soft drink company, G-Spot, and her new book, Want (out Sept. 5), which is a collection of letters written and submitted anonymously by women around the world confessing their sexual desires. Anderson's is inspired by Nancy Friday's My Secret Garden.

“Did you submit a letter,” Colbert asked Anderson, who replied: “I did, thank you very much.”

Anderson is known for turning heads on the red carpet. In fact, she’s well aware of all the daring moments she has taken in the past.

Shortly after debuting the vulva look on Jan. 7, Anderson took to Instagram with a reel looking back at her most skin-revealing dresses — including the extremely backless one she wore to the 2001 Vanity Fair Oscar afterparty. Way ahead of her time, Anderson arrived in an Eduardo Lucero dress that, while beautiful from the front, stole the show from the backside with its thong-exposing cut.

Her bold attitude towards fashion was also present at the 2024 British Fashion Awards, where she stole the carpet spotlight in a red velvet Valentino gown that dipped down to her navel in the front and all the way down her back.
